#8E371A Color
#8E371A is rgb(142, 55, 26) in RGB, hsl(15, 69%, 33%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 61%, 82%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Kobe (#882D17),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.96.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#8E371A Channel Values
How #8E371A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 142 · G 55 · B 26 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 15° · S 69% · L 33%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 15° · S 82%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 61% · Y 82%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 7.74:1 vs white · 2.71: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#8E371A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#8E371A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#8E371A?
#8E371A is a dark brown — rgb(142, 55, 26) in RGB and hsl(15, 69%, 33%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Kobe (#882D17),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.96.
What is the RGB value of #8E371A?
#8E371A is rgb(142, 55, 26) — red 142, green 55, and blue 26 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#8E371A?
#8E371A conver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 61%, 82%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#8E371A be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#8E371A scores 7.74:1 against white and 2.71: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#8E371A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#8E371A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is saddlebrown (#8B4513) at a CIE76 distance of 10.05, which is visibly different.
